As a visitor to Mt. Hope Estates & Winery, whether for the traditional Pennsylvania Renaissance Faire (weekends mid-August through October, including Labor Day Monday), or the Celtic Fling Weekend, you can see Wellcat Herbs' beautiful gardens (featuring a wide variety of 16th century herbs) and purchase any of the many retail items, including live plants.

Proprietor of Wellcat Herbs, Ruth Roy—known to faire-goers as Mistress Ruth—gladly offers gardening advice, information on how to harvest, preserve & use herbs, as well as a tale or two on the folklore & magic of herbs and spices.  Ruth has taught a number of herb classes at the local community college & will soon be offering classes at other locations, including field trips to her Renaissance Herb Garden.  To be on the mailing list for future herb classes, please email   info@wellcat.com.

At the Pennsylvania Renaissance Faire, you will find performance art as much a part of the presentation as the herbal products themselves.  In short, a visit to the Herb Garden & Apothecary is a total interactive experience.  Mistress Ruth is always there, providing gardening tips, tales of folklore & secrets to making the best & longest lasting potpourri, as well as how to harvest & use herbs for cooking.
